Title: “Environmental Governance in China”
Speaker: Dr. BAO Maohong (RIHN Visiting Researcher /
Department of History, Peking University)
Summary:
China's environment today is the result of historical interactions between humanity and the rest of nature. Contemporary environmental problems should therefore be examined in the context of this environmental history, and environmental governance should take account of the interaction of both internal and external forces. This presentation will analyze how contemporary environmental governance in China is influenced through the interaction of state (central and local), market, civil society and international dynamics or forces.
